Pork: Shoulder
Pork shoulder encompasses the front legs of the pig as well as the area above the legs. Pork from the shoulder is fattier than other parts of the pork and is thus particularly tender and flavorful ... Pork: Side
The side is the underside of the pig between the front and back legs. It is beneath the loin and is often called the belly . Pork: Leg
Also referred to as the ham , the leg of the pig encompasses the back legs and the rump above the legs.
